M. Stephen Doherty

M.Stephen Doherty was introduced to plein air (outdoor) painting by Thomas S. Buechner who knew that being able to carry painting supplies on business trips, family vacations, and weekend outings would allow him to continue painting while balancing the demands of jobs and family. Doherty became so enthusiastic that he organized groups of artists to paint in special locations, judged plein air festivals, lectured and demonstrated, and eventually he became the editor of PleinAir magazine.

Doherty earned a Master of Fine Arts degree from Cornell University; taught art in public schools, colleges, and workshops; worked for an art-materials manufacturer; served as editor-in-chief of American Artist magazine for 31 years; and is now editor of PleinAir magazine (www.outdoorpainter.com). He exhibited his paintings in solo and group exhibitions; served on the advisory boards of art schools and artists’ organizations; judged art exhibitions for museums and art societies, and has written a dozen art books and hundreds of magazine articles. He just published a book about plein air painting with Monacelli Studio Press. He and his wife, Sara, moved to Waynesboro, VA in December, 2012, and both have been thoroughly enjoying the local community of artists and art enthusiasts.
